如何在.NET框架中使用C#语言在Visual Studio 2021环境下创建一个具有基本播放和在线搜索功能的简易音乐播放器?
时间: 2024-10-28 16:14:04 浏览: 20
本问题的回答将引导你如何利用.NET框架和Visual Studio 2021,通过C#语言开发一个简易音乐播放器。首先,你需要确保对.NET框架有基础的理解,它将为你的音乐播放器提供运行环境和音频解码等核心功能支持。Visual Studio 2021作为开发IDE,提供了强大的工具集和调试环境,是开发此类应用的理想选择。
参考资源链接:[C#实现:简易音乐播放器设计与Visual Studio 2021应用](https://wenku.csdn.net/doc/2n4d7rttd5?spm=1055.2569.3001.10343)
接下来,你可以参考《C#实现:简易音乐播放器设计与Visual Studio 2021应用》这篇毕业设计论文,该文详细介绍了音乐播放器的设计和实现过程。从界面设计开始,理解如何使用Windows Forms或WPF构建用户界面,实现播放、暂停、停止等基本控制按钮。对于后台代码,你需要了解如何通过.NET提供的音频处理类如`SoundPlayer`或`MediaPlayer`来控制音乐文件的播放。同时,为了实现在线搜索功能,你可以使用网络通信类如`HttpClient`来请求网络服务,搜索并获取音乐信息。
在具体实现音乐播放器时,你应该先构建一个清晰的类结构,例如将播放器功能拆分为播放控制、歌曲管理、在线搜索等模块。此外,考虑到用户体验,应该提供一个直观的用户界面,以及在播放音乐时显示歌词的功能。开发过程中,保持代码的可读性和可维护性同样重要。
通过上述步骤,你将能够创建一个既满足功能需求又具有良好用户体验的简易音乐播放器。在掌握了这些基础概念和实现方法后,可以进一步探索更多高级功能,比如播放列表管理、音效处理、歌词同步显示等。
参考资源链接:[C#实现:简易音乐播放器设计与Visual Studio 2021应用](https://wenku.csdn.net/doc/2n4d7rttd5?spm=1055.2569.3001.10343)
阅读全文